首页 百科 正文

1.Python

大数据编程语言大数据编程语言在处理大数据时,选择合适的编程语言是非常重要的。以下是一些主要用于大数据处理的编程语言:Python是一种简单易学的编程语言,广泛应用于数据科学和大数据处理领域。它有丰富的...
大数据编程语言

大数据编程语言

在处理大数据时,选择合适的编程语言是非常重要的。以下是一些主要用于大数据处理的编程语言:

Python是一种简单易学的编程语言,广泛应用于数据科学和大数据处理领域。它有丰富的库和工具,如NumPy、Pandas和SciPy,可以帮助处理大规模数据集。

Java是一种跨平台的编程语言,适合开发大型分布式系统和处理大数据。Hadoop和Spark等大数据处理框架都是用Java编写的。

Scala是一种运行在Java虚拟机上的多范式编程语言,被广泛用于Apache Spark等大数据处理框架。它结合了面向对象编程和函数式编程的特性。

R是一种专门用于统计分析和数据可视化的编程语言。在大数据处理中,R通常用于数据探索和建模。

结构化查询语言(SQL)是用于管理和操作关系型数据库的标准语言。在大数据处理中,SQL可以用于查询和处理结构化数据。

在选择大数据处理编程语言时,需要考虑以下因素:

  • 数据规模:不同编程语言适合处理不同规模的数据,需要根据实际情况选择。
  • 任务复杂度:某些编程语言更适合处理复杂的大数据任务,如分布式计算。
  • 团队技能:考虑团队成员的技能水平和熟悉程度,选择他们熟悉的编程语言。
  • 生态系统:考虑编程语言的生态系统,是否有丰富的库和工具支持。

选择合适的大数据处理编程语言取决于具体的需求和情况,可以根据以上介绍的编程语言特点进行选择。